Tender Overview

Bharat Petroleum Corporation Ltd invites bids for desilting of oil catcher II & III, MAIN OIL CATCHER (MOC) BASIN, FIRE WATER BASIN, SWPH BASIN and NEW UNDERGROUND FIRE RESERVOIR BASIN at BPCL Mumbai Refinery, Mumbai, Maharashtra. The scope covers critical basin desilting works at multiple hydraulic basins within a single refinery complex. The bid includes an EMD of ₹2,50,000 and potential contract quantity/duration adjustments up to 25% per ATC terms. No BOQ items are published, indicating a scope-based service contract with site-specific execution. The procurement emphasizes safety-compliant trenching, debris removal, and wastewater handling within defined refinery zones. The ATC terms may modify scope post-bid but require bidders to accept revised quantities/durations. This tender targets experienced desilting/service contractors capable of working in a high-hazard industrial environment and coordinating with BPCL Mumbai operations.
